As some of you well informed fans already know, the "Y&R" stages are located next door to the venerable game show, "The Price is Right." What you might not realize is that the "Price" stagehands store all of their prizes - everything from bedroom sets to couches to cars - right outside the "Y&R" dressing rooms. This can prove a little hazardous, as the Insider was once nearly clobbered by an approaching sailboat! "Y&R" veterans know to keep an eye peeled for moving furniture as they chat in the hallways, and, as the Insider was curtly reminded today, "Don't sit on the props!"
